Variant summary

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_152721.6(DOK6):c.820C>T(p.Arg274Cys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000149 in 1,614,028 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
DOK6 (HGNC:28301): (docking protein 6) DOK6 is a member of the DOK (see DOK1; MIM 602919) family of intracellular adaptors that play a role in the RET (MIM 164761) signaling cascade (Crowder et al., 2004 [PubMed 15286081]).[supplied by OMIM, Mar 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Jul 19, 2023The c.820C>T (p.R274C) alteration is located in exon 7 (coding exon 7) of the DOK6 gene. This alteration results from a C to T substitution at nucleotide position 820, causing the arginine (R) at amino acid position 274 to be replaced by a cysteine (C).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
